Corr delighted with Robins strikes

Sun 30 Dec, 04:30 PM


Swindon striker Barry Corr rated the first of his two goals in the 2-2 draw at Bournemouth among the best of his football career.Corr, who had scored in Swindon's two previous wins over Hartlepool and Yeovil, lit the fuse on a terrific second half by scoring a gem three minutes after the break - a 25-yard curling shot into the top right hand corner.

"I honestly can't remember too many better goals than that, but it was such a pity we didn't go on and build on that advantage," he said.

The tall striker opened Swindon's account three minutes after the break and then salvaged a point for the visitors for the late equaliser after Jo Kuffour and Sam Vokes had given the home side a 2-1 lead.
